Description
About this awesome coffee – Mountain: 1,700 MASL Variety: Caturra, Bourbon, Pache, Catuai Process: Washed Producer: Francisco Morales Roaster notes: "What a joy to roast this coffee, with lovely complexity and gentle white grape and raspberry acidity and a sweet sticky finish. This coffee is perfect for pour overs, cafetiere and your AeroPress". This wonderful coffee lot comes from Huehuetenango in Guatemala—high altitude, limestone soils, and ideal conditions for producing really elegant coffees.
